I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ET Discussion :

Erreur de changement de mot de passe sur un server


Sujet :

ASP.NET

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é Avatar de SonnyFab
    Étudiant
    Inscrit en
    Mai 2010
    Messages
    498
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2010
    Messages : 498
    Par défaut Erreur de changement de mot de passe sur un server
    Bonjour,
    Lorsque j'éffectue depuis mon application hébergée sur un server une mise à jour d'un nom cela me génère une erreur
    Invalid postback or callback argument. Event validation is enabled using <pages enableEventValidation="true"/> in configuration or <%@ Page EnableEventValidation="true" %> in a page. For security purposes, this feature verifies that arguments to postback or callback events originate from the server control that originally rendered them. If the data is valid and expected, use the ClientScriptManager.RegisterForEventValidation method in order to register the postback or callback data for validation.
    Or cette action passe très bien en local, j'ai beau cherché je ne me retrouve pas, en espérant une aide de votre part je vous donne un bout de mon code

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    sub Envoie (ByVal sender As Object, ByVal e As System.EventArgs) 
    'Ici c est la connexion '
     try 
    	      'Exécution dune requête SELECT'
               Dim myCommand As New SqlCommand("Update dbo.UTILISATEURS set PassUser='"+zeConfPass.Text+"' where NomUser='"+name+"'", objConnection)
               Dim myReader As SqlDataReader = myCommand.ExecuteReader()
               success.Text="<br/> Changement de mot de passe réussie ! <br/>"
    	       myReader.Close()
     catch i as Exception
    		   success.Text="<br/>Echec lors du changement de mot de passe !<br/>"
    		   success.Text=i.ToString ()
    		 end try
    Voila, je me demandais aussi si le problème ne venais pas du server
    Merci

  2. #2
    Rédacteur
    Avatar de lutecefalco
    Profil pro
    zadzdzddzdzd
    Inscrit en
    Juillet 2005
    Messages
    5 052
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: zadzdzddzdzd

    Informations forums :
    Inscription : Juillet 2005
    Messages : 5 052
    Par défaut
    Tu saisis quoi comme password?

    Puis ton code est une vraie passoire point de vue sécurité

  3. #3
    Membre éclairé Avatar de SonnyFab
    Étudiant
    Inscrit en
    Mai 2010
    Messages
    498
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2010
    Messages : 498
    Par défaut
    Tu saisis quoi comme password?
    Ben un nom que je rentre dans un textBox
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    <td>
    <!-- Mot de passe -->
    <asp:Label id="NvZaPass" runat="server" Text="Nouveau Mot de passe:"></asp:Label></td>
    <td>
    <asp:TextBox id="zePass" runat="server" MaxLength="30" TextMode="Password"></asp:TextBox></td>
    <td>
    <asp:Label ID="zaErrPass" runat="server" Text=""></asp:Label></td></tr>
     
    <tr>
    <td>
    <!-- Confirmation de passe -->
    <asp:Label ID="NvZaConfPass" runat="server" Text="Confirmation du nouveau Mot de Passe :"></asp:Label></td>
    <td>
    <asp:TextBox Id="zeConfPass" runat="server" MaxLength="30" TextMode="Password"></asp:TextBox></td>
    <td>
    <asp:Label Id="zaErrConfPass" runat="server" text=""></asp:Label></td></tr>
    Puis ton code est une vraie passoire point de vue sécurité
    Oh la la! Je me disais aussi mais j'ai pas encore acquis toutes les fonctionnalités de sécurité en asp.net

  4. #4
    Rédacteur
    Avatar de lutecefalco
    Profil pro
    zadzdzddzdzd
    Inscrit en
    Juillet 2005
    Messages
    5 052
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: zadzdzddzdzd

    Informations forums :
    Inscription : Juillet 2005
    Messages : 5 052
    Par défaut
    Citation Envoyé par SonnyFab Voir le message
    Ben un nom que je rentre dans un textBox
    Ca j'ai bien compris, mais tu rentres pas un < ou un >?

  5. #5
    Membre éclairé Avatar de SonnyFab
    Étudiant
    Inscrit en
    Mai 2010
    Messages
    498
    Détails du profil
    Informations personnelles :
    Âge : 35

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2010
    Messages : 498
    Par défaut
    Non Lucetefalco juste un nom simple!
    Enfait en cherchant de mon coté et en modifiant certains trucs je me suis rendu compte que c'est juste au clic de la fonction 'envoie' et non de la mise à jour
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    sub Envoie (ByVal sender As Object, ByVal e As System.EventArgs)
    qu'il me générait l'érreur, tiens même en vidant cette fonction de cette façon :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    sub Envoie (ByVal sender As Object, ByVal e As System.EventArgs) 
     
       end sub
    Juste pour voir son déroulement, eh bien il bug toujours

  6. #6
    Rédacteur
    Avatar de lutecefalco
    Profil pro
    zadzdzddzdzd
    Inscrit en
    Juillet 2005
    Messages
    5 052
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: zadzdzddzdzd

    Informations forums :
    Inscription : Juillet 2005
    Messages : 5 052
    Par défaut
    Tu fais de l'ajax?

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[SBI] Lien sur changement de mot de passe introuvable(2.8)
    Par rotsilaina dans le forum SpagoBI
    Réponses: 0
    Dernier message: 17/03/2011, 15h13
  2. Réponses: 2
    Dernier message: 29/10/2008, 12h16
  3. script pour automatiser le changement de mot de passe sur plusieurs hosts
    Par abiyas dans le forum Applications et environnements graphiques
    Réponses: 3
    Dernier message: 16/11/2007, 14h15
  4. Probleme avec changement du mot de passe utilisateur
    Par Davenico dans le forum Outils
    Réponses: 2
    Dernier message: 19/12/2003, 14h42

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o